Bison Futé Flags ‘Red’ and ‘Black’ Traffic Days for 11 July Holiday Exodus
France’s national traffic information agency, Bison Futé, published its forecast for the long week-end of 10–14 July 2026, warning that Saturday 11 July will be classed ‘ROUGE’ nationwide and ‘NOIR’ (the highest congestion level) in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es, the North and the Grand-Ouest. The second week of school holidays coincides with mass departures to Atlantic and Mediterranean coasts and with Bastille Day falling on the following Tuesday. According to the 11-page bulletin, outbound jams are expected from before dawn on the A10 and A6 south of Paris, the A7 between Lyon and Orange, and the A13 towards Normandy. The Mont-Blanc and Fréjus tunnels will see wait times of up to two hours. Bison Futé advises motorists to cross Île-de-France before 04:00 or after 18:00 on Saturday, avoid the A11 Le Mans–Angers corridor at midday, and steer clear of the A63 Bordeaux–Bayonne section late morning. Inbound traffic is classified ‘orange’ on Mediterranean axes, notably the A9 Narbonne–Nîmes. For relocation companies, coach operators and logistics providers, the colour codes translate into higher driver-hours, potential breach of EU driving-time limits and re-routing costs. Corporate travel managers should consider rail alternatives or staggered departure times for assignees and their families.
